Description
Hello,
We are Siobhan and Tom, a couple living at the bottom of the Waitakere ranges in Auckland City.
We live on a 10 acre lifestyle block, with some very friendly fat sheep, a few chickens, and a dog. With a car, we are not too far from some of the Wild West coast beaches of Auckland like bethels or Piha, and there are a lot of beautiful hikes the area.
Auckland is a big city, and there is a lot to see and explore. The property is semi-rural, but is located within the city and Auckland central is about 30 minutes drive away. -

Help
We are looking for people to do some gardening work around the house. It’s a large property and there is plenty of opportunity to take initiative. You could also help clean/ tidy within the house if you would like.
Things that need doing include:
- lawn mowing (both with ride on, and push mower)
- weeding/ spraying
- pool maintenance
- pruning
- general tidying of the outside
- vacuuming/ cleaning the house -

Accommodation
You would have your own bedroom, and access to a separate toilet nearby. The kitchen is shared, as are living spaces but it is a big house, with a lot of space.
